CRICKET.
N.S.W. v. SOUTH AUSTRALIA. (United Press Association—.Copyright.) Received December 18, 5.5 p.m. ADELAIDE, December 19. New South Wales, playing against South Australia, made 184 in the first innings, E. Wadcly <H8). Gow, and Minnett (11 each) being tlie chief scorers. ADELAIDE, December 19. South Australia. —'Four wickets for 184 runs (Golirs 72, Clem Hill 94). Cricketers were again favoured with fine "weather on Saturday until late in the afternoon, when rain set in and fielding was mads difficult. SENIOR. WANGANUI v. ST. PAUL'S. WANGANUI.—First Innings.
